Output 50af50139f3b30e21c78d0964b21321f1701b142109a41b81c65e62c0fa5118b:1

value
210330
script pubkey
OP_0 OP_PUSHBYTES_20 851f1d633c1ba943bd93a613a03a9253f8861225
address
ltc1qs5036ceurw5580vn5cf6qw5j20ugvy392lacft
transaction
50af50139f3b30e21c78d0964b21321f1701b142109a41b81c65e62c0fa5118b
spent
true